ตั้งค่า SDK ของ Android 12
จัดทุกอย่างให้เป็นระเบียบอยู่เสมอด้วยคอลเล็กชัน
บันทึกและจัดหมวดหมู่เนื้อหาตามค่ากำหนดของคุณ
เพื่อพัฒนาด้วย Android 12 API และทดสอบแอปด้วยลักษณะการทำงานของ Android 12
คุณต้องตั้งค่า SDK ของ Android 12 โปรดทำตามวิธีการในเรื่องนี้
สำหรับการตั้งค่า Android 12 SDK ใน Android Studio รวมถึงสร้างและเรียกใช้แอป
ใน Android 12
ดาวน์โหลด Android Studio
Android 12 SDK มีการเปลี่ยนแปลงที่เข้ากันไม่ได้กับ
เวอร์ชัน Android Studio เพื่อประสบการณ์การพัฒนาแอป Android ที่ดีที่สุด
12 SDK, ใช้ Android Studio Arctic Fox | 2020.3.1 ขึ้นไป
ดาวน์โหลด Android Studio
ติดตั้ง SDK
ใน Android Studio คุณจะติดตั้ง SDK ของ Android 12 ได้โดยทำดังนี้
- คลิกเครื่องมือ > SDK Manager
- ในแท็บแพลตฟอร์ม SDK ให้ขยายส่วน Android 12.0 ("S") และ
เลือกแพ็กเกจ Android SDK Platform 31
- ในแท็บเครื่องมือ SDK ให้ขยายส่วน Android SDK Build-Tools 34
แล้วเลือก
31.x.x
เวอร์ชันล่าสุด
- คลิกใช้ > ตกลงเพื่อดาวน์โหลดและติดตั้งแพ็กเกจที่เลือก
อัปเดตการกำหนดค่าบิลด์ของแอป
หากต้องการเข้าถึง API ของ Android 12 และทดสอบความเข้ากันได้ของแอปกับ Android 12 ให้ทำดังนี้
เปิดไฟล์ build.gradle
หรือ build.gradle.kts
ระดับโมดูล และอัปเดต
compileSdkVersion
และ targetSdkVersion
ที่มีค่าสำหรับ Android 12:
ดึงดูด
android {
compileSdkVersion 31
defaultConfig {
targetSdkVersion 31
}
}
Kotlin
android {
compileSdkVersion(31)
defaultConfig {
targetSdkVersion(31)
}
}
เพื่อดูว่าการเปลี่ยนแปลงใดบ้างที่อาจส่งผลกระทบต่อคุณ และเรียนรู้วิธีทดสอบการเปลี่ยนแปลงเหล่านี้
การเปลี่ยนแปลงในแอป โปรดอ่านหัวข้อต่อไปนี้
หากต้องการดูข้อมูลเพิ่มเติมเกี่ยวกับ API และฟีเจอร์ใหม่ๆ ที่พร้อมใช้งานใน Android 12 โปรดอ่าน Android
12 ฟีเจอร์
ตัวอย่างเนื้อหาและโค้ดในหน้าเว็บนี้ขึ้นอยู่กับใบอนุญาตที่อธิบายไว้ในใบอนุญาตการใช้เนื้อหา Java และ OpenJDK เป็นเครื่องหมายการค้าหรือเครื่องหมายการค้าจดทะเบียนของ Oracle และ/หรือบริษัทในเครือ
อัปเดตล่าสุด 2024-08-20 UTC
[{
"type": "thumb-down",
"id": "missingTheInformationINeed",
"label":"ไม่มีข้อมูลที่ฉันต้องการ"
},{
"type": "thumb-down",
"id": "tooComplicatedTooManySteps",
"label":"ซับซ้อนเกินไป/มีหลายขั้นตอนมากเกินไป"
},{
"type": "thumb-down",
"id": "outOfDate",
"label":"ล้าสมัย"
},{
"type": "thumb-down",
"id": "translationIssue",
"label":"ปัญหาเกี่ยวกับการแปล"
},{
"type": "thumb-down",
"id": "samplesCodeIssue",
"label":"ตัวอย่าง/ปัญหาเกี่ยวกับโค้ด"
},{
"type": "thumb-down",
"id": "otherDown",
"label":"อื่นๆ"
}]
[{
"type": "thumb-up",
"id": "easyToUnderstand",
"label":"เข้าใจง่าย"
},{
"type": "thumb-up",
"id": "solvedMyProblem",
"label":"แก้ปัญหาของฉันได้"
},{
"type": "thumb-up",
"id": "otherUp",
"label":"อื่นๆ"
}]
{"lastModified": "\u0e2d\u0e31\u0e1b\u0e40\u0e14\u0e15\u0e25\u0e48\u0e32\u0e2a\u0e38\u0e14 2024-08-20 UTC"}
[[["เข้าใจง่าย","easyToUnderstand","thumb-up"],["แก้ปัญหาของฉันได้","solvedMyProblem","thumb-up"],["อื่นๆ","otherUp","thumb-up"]],[["ไม่มีข้อมูลที่ฉันต้องการ","missingTheInformationINeed","thumb-down"],["ซับซ้อนเกินไป/มีหลายขั้นตอนมากเกินไป","tooComplicatedTooManySteps","thumb-down"],["ล้าสมัย","outOfDate","thumb-down"],["ปัญหาเกี่ยวกับการแปล","translationIssue","thumb-down"],["ตัวอย่าง/ปัญหาเกี่ยวกับโค้ด","samplesCodeIssue","thumb-down"],["อื่นๆ","otherDown","thumb-down"]],["อัปเดตล่าสุด 2024-08-20 UTC"]]